Associate Consultant - NICU
Apollo Imperial Hospitals
Job Description / Responsibility
- Core Clinical & Procedural Responsibilities
- Critical Neonatal Care: Deliver expert, evidence-based management for extremely premature, low birth weight, and complex surgical neonates from admission through discharge.
- Delivery & Stabilization: Lead high-risk delivery attendances and execute immediate, advanced resuscitation and stabilization according to current Neonatal Resuscitation Program (NRP) guidelines.
- Advanced Ventilatory Support: Independently manage and troubleshoot invasive and non-invasive respiratory support, including conventional ventilation, High-Frequency Oscillatory Ventilation (HFOV), CPAP, and HFNC.
- Invasive Procedure Mastery: Perform and supervise critical procedures, including Umbilical Venous/Arterial Catheterization (UVC/UAC), PICC line insertion, chest tube placement, and exchange transfusions.
- Point-of-Care Diagnostics: Interpret real-time diagnostic modalities, including Point-of-Care Ultrasound (POCUS), basic cranial ultrasounds, target neonatal echocardiography, and serial blood gases.
- Metabolic & Nutritional Management: Formulate precise fluid, electrolyte, and acid-base strategies, including the calculation of complex Total Parenteral Nutrition (TPN) and advanced enteral feeding protocols.
- Leadership, Quality, & Operations
- Team Supervision & Handovers: Direct and evaluate the clinical performance of residents, interns, and specialized nursing staff, ensuring seamless 24/7 care continuity via structured JCI-compliant handovers.
- Emergency Team Leadership: Act as the designated team leader during NICU emergencies, Code Blue responses, disaster situations, and specialized outbound neonatal transport operations.
- Resource & Bed Optimization: Partner with hospital administration to manage bed capacity, triage admissions, optimize biomedical equipment utilization, and streamline resource allocation.
- Accreditation & Safety Compliance: Maintain strict adherence to Joint Commission International (JCI) standards, International Patient Safety Goals (IPSGs), and rigorous infection control/antibiotic stewardship practices.
- Clinical Governance & QI: Lead departmental quality improvement (QI) initiatives, clinical audits, and multidisciplinary Mortality and Morbidity (M&M) reviews, participating in Root Cause Analyses (RCA) when required.
- Communication, Collaboration, & Academics
- Interdepartmental Liaison: Coordinate multi-system care pathways with Obstetrics, Maternal-Fetal Medicine, Pediatric Surgery, Radiology, and other specialized multidisciplinary medical teams.
- Empathetic Family Counseling: Deliver compassionate, culturally sensitive updates and end-of-life counseling to families, ensuring robust informed consent and a family-centered care model.
- Bedside Teaching & Mentorship: Design and deliver clinical training, simulation-based emergency drills, and formal competency assessments for junior medical and nursing personnel.
- Documentation, Research & CME: Maintain flawless Electronic Medical Record (EMR) integrity while actively participating in clinical research, guideline development, and mandatory Continuous Medical Education (CME).
